Job Purpose
We're looking for a self-starter with press office experience to join our PR team as a Junior Press Officer. Reporting to the PR Manager, you will bring excellent written and verbal communication skills and a keen news sense to help us deliver proactive and reactive media activities.
Key Responsibilities
Press office functions, including closely monitoring the news agenda, seeking proactive and reactive opportunities for CMI to bring our expertise in leadership and management to bear and comment on fast-moving events.
Identify media opportunities to raise the profile of our key policies, in-house research and the wider value of CMI accreditation.
Respond to phone calls and emails from journalists in a timely fashion.
Lead on drafting timely and engaging social media content related to Policy and External Affairs, working closely with the social media to both develop and draft content plans and offer wider support to Marketing campaigns.
Develop and build media contacts and keep abreast of developments relevant to CMI.
Create and deliver detailed coverage and engagement reports and campaign evaluations.
Support the wider team on other ad hoc tasks such as political monitoring, social media monitoring and public affairs support.
